FLOYD MAYWEATHER GETS APOLOGY FROM RIZIN AFTER GOON THROWS FLOWERS AT HIS FEET – FIGHT WITH DEJI IS OFFICIAL
Las Vegas, Nevada (September 27th, 2022)– Floyd Mayweather’s Global Titans Fight Series has made it official with his fight with Deji in Dubai on November 13th.
Mayweather is coming off a 2nd round KO performance against RIZIN MMA star Mikuru Asakura this past Saturday in Japan. Also, Mayweather defeated his friend Don House in an exhibition in Dubai last May. Mayweather has also expressed future interest in fighting Manny Pacquiao and Conor McGregor in rematches for 2023.
The YouTube star, Deji, (1-0, 1ko) the brother of KSI, does have one professional boxing win over fellow YouTuber Yousef ‘Fousey’ Erakat by stopping him by TKO in round 2.
Tommy Fury, 23, (8-0, 4 Kos), the half-brother of Tyson is rumored to be on the undercard against Puerto Rican light-heavyweight Paul Bamba.

Rizin President Apologizes to Floyd Mayweather
Tokyo, Japan (September 27th, 2022)– President of Rizin, Noboyuki Sakakibara, has issued an apology for some of the behavior Floyd Mayweather experienced at Rizin 38.
Prior to this fight, at some Japanese combat sports events it is a custom, there was a ceremony where the fighters are presented with flowers. Tossing them to the ground is a clear act of disrespect.
Rizin President Noboyuki Sakakibara was extremely displeased at the treatment Mayweather received prior to his second bout with the promotion. He took to Instagram after the event to apologize for the behavior of this individual, promising that it will never happen again.
“Thank you for all who attended, and tuned in for today’s event. I truly appreciate all 22 fighters from the bottom of my heart. And again, we deeply apologize for letting such a vile individual step into the sacred ring. We promise that we will make sure such actions will never be taken place ever again,” Sakakibara wrote.
The disrespectful guy who tossed the flowers has been identified as Takushi Okuno, the leader of the Burdock political party. The South China Morning Post’s Nicolas Atkin describes them as “a small political party that failed to win a single seat in Japan’s 2022 Upper House.”
In an interview with EastSportsWeb Okuno was unapologetic for the incident, and claimed it was a response to Mayweather’s conduct around his 2018 bout against Tenshin Nasukawa. Mayweather made his opponent wait a few extra hours to get his hands wrapped.
